KP Engine Camshaft Seal
KP 09283 32026 Engine Camshaft Seal
No Core Charge Required
Parts Interchange: 0928332026, 09283 32026, 22550001310, 225 50001 310
No Core Charge Required
Parts Interchange: 0928332026, 09283 32026, 22550001310, 225 50001 310
KP Engine Camshaft Seal
Sale price$3.92 USD